OCALA, Fla. - ClosetMaid will showcase expanded product lines at the 2019 NAHB International Builders Show (IBS), to be held February 19-21 at the Las Vegas Convention Center.

MasterSuite, known for maximizing storage space in any residential or commercial application, offers a premium suite of textured wood styles, soft touch finishes, and hardware for high-end projects. The program’s Classic and 27th Avenue Collections are made from industrial-grade engineered wood with a durable melamine finish and solid wood drawers. Both MasterSuite collections provide a variety of configurations of shelving, cabinets, drawers, hang rods and other accessories to accommodate any space in the home.

In response to customer demand, ClosetMaid added the following enhancements to the product line:

  • Flat, modern accent drawer fronts in a new, Deep Blue finish
  • Full, back panels in 10 distinct and on-trend finishes for both collections:

o Classic (White, Antique White, Chocolate Pear, Coastal Gray)

o 27th Avenue (Deep Blue, Timeless Taupe, Clean Slate, Washed White, Natural Blonde and Modern Gray)

  • Expansion of the current hardware selection to include an Oil Rubbed Bronze finish
  • New accessories with pullouts in Matte Aluminum and Oil Rubbed Bronze finishes, including a jewelry organizer, deep drawer, pant organizer, shoe organizer, laundry organizer, storage box, acrylic shelf divider and shoe fence.

These accessories also offer flat drawer faces for a more muted appearance.

  • Scribe and base molding
  • Diagonal corner shelves, allowing for easier installation of crown and base molding

In addition to these new items, MasterSuite’s full-range of finishes, door and drawer styles, center islands and hardware options will be on display during the show in a variety of real-world applications within the home.

ExpressShelf, a design and build, pre-finished shelf and rod system, now includes a new collection of premium ventilated wood shelving and hardware featuring the warmth of solid wood.

The new premium ventilated wood shelving is available in 12-inch and 14-inch depths and comes in White and Chocolate Pear finishes. It also features a variety of new components including shelf cap kits, trim, shelf joiner caps and angled support brackets.

ExpressShelf is also available in basic laminate and melamine solid wood shelving and can be combined with ClosetMaid’s MasterSuite top shelves and closet rods for additional upgrade options.

ClosetMaid is previewing a smart evolution to its popular ShelfTrack system. The redesigned adjustable system meets many needs and is affordable. Mixing the richness of wood with a more efficient mounting system, the flexibility is ideal for a variety of applications – from single-family homes and multi-family projects to hospitality and senior living.

All new system hardware components allow for fast and easy installation. The versatile slotted design of the new hang track makes wall installation more efficient than ever. As an added benefit, the hang track has an optional cover to hide slots and screws. The standards offer a new free hang option in certain configurations, easy bracket alignment, and are compatible with new or existing ShelfTrack hang tracks and brackets.

The new product line also features pre-cut, melamine shelving and hardware in numerous sizes (24- to 96-inches) and shelving depths (12-, 14- and 16-inches). The shelving comes pre-edge banded reducing fabrication time and provides a finished look. Other wood accessories include drawer kits with modern and traditional drawer fronts, shoe shelf kits and hang rods. The hardware, shelving and accessories are available in a clean, White finish; while the accessories offer hardware with Satin and Chrome accents.
